Cara Mengatasi Error Pada Joomla : “Error displaying the error page: Application Instantiation Error”

Waktu Baca : < 1 menit

Jika saat Anda mengakses web joomla Anda dan muncul tulisan : “Error displaying the error page: Application Instantiation Error”, tidak usah panik.

Biasanya hal ini muncul karena :

  1. Username database pada file configuration.php tidak sesuai dengan yang ada di hosting Anda
  2. Password database di configuration.php salah
  3. Hostname database di configuration.php salah

Silahkan cek kembali konfigurasi database Anda. Jika ternyata salah, silahkan perbaiki. Untuk hostname, umumnya menggunakan : localhost

Jika ternyata tidak terjadi kesalahan penulisan, maka bisa jadi penyebabnya karena script joomla Anda tidak cocok dengan versi php hosting. Misalnya versi php hosting Anda tersetting 5.4, maka Anda bisa coba turunkan ke 5.3 dan lihat hasilnya.

Selamat mencoba!

Fungsi PHP Suexec pada Web Server

Waktu Baca : < 1 menit

PHP Suexec adalah sebuah fitur atau modul yang dapat disisipkan ke dalam sebuah web server, terutama Apache dan litespeed, yang membuat semua script php yang kita buat dapat memiliki otoritas seperti unix user.

Misalnya jika kita menulis sebuah file html, maka kita tidak perlu
repot untuk mengubah chmod-nya, karena pada PHP Suexec ini dijalankan atas user kita masing-masing, sehingga otoritasnya sama dengan ketika kita menuliskan sebuah file pada saat kita masuk ke dalam konsol (shell).

Keuntungannya :
1. Setiap vHost tidak akan menembus folder /home orang lain yang bukan haknya, sehingga tingkat keamanan lebih baik.

2. Setiap user tidak perlu membuat folder atau file yang diset chmod-nya menjadi 777 supaya bisa ditulis, sehingga dapat mempermudah semua user.

3. Setiap proses PHP dapat kita identifikasi apabila terjadi overload terhadap
server kita.